Supervising Producer

Dow Jones · New York, NY · 3 wk ago
Art & Creative$130k–$160k/yrFull-time

About the team: The Wall Street Journal & Barron’s Group, The TRUST, is a fast-growing team of energetic writers, content and creative strategists, videographers, designers, editors and developers. The work spans a variety of forms—short- and long-form reported articles, immersive digital experiences, documentary videos, data visualizations, animations and more. This is an on-site (NYC) full-time position that will work across various clients and in-house brands including The Wall Street Journal, WSJ. Magazine, MarketWatch, Barron’s, Mansion Global, Moneyish, and more.

About the role

The Supervising Producer will report to the Director of Production and work with a team of producers, video editors, and freelancers.

Responsibilities

  • Drive the creation of the highest quality original creative content and narratives.
  • Work on revenue-earning campaigns at varying levels at $750k+.
  • Help pitch creative ideas regularly and in response to briefs, and price accordingly.
  • Strategize new and effective solutions for client asks and products.
  • Build and develop a strong external network of freelancers, agencies, and directors to cover various commissioned works.
  • Be aware of market prices and negotiate and challenge where necessary.
  • Own the communication with all stakeholders to manage video projects from end to end.
  • Ensure visual quality and accuracy of details are paramount throughout.
  • Define, manage, and develop projects on schedule and within budget.
  • Manage multiple production jobs at the same time from concept, hiring, project planning, directors, casting, and post-production.
  • Manage the internal relationship with the legal team to ensure appropriate contracts & licensing within international legal boundaries.
  • Lead on-set production.

Requirements

  • 10+ years of experience in a busy production role.
  • An experienced, creative video producer with strong knowledge of luxury, travel, finance, CPG, Tech, and TMT, in both editorial and branded content.
  • A brimming contacts book of global directors, production, and crew, aligned to the standard of the Wall Street Journal brand.
  • Experience negotiating with production and talent representatives.
  • A strategic thinker with a strong knowledge and understanding of the global digital state of play of video.
  • Highly self-motivated, problem solver, and willing to go the extra mile.
  • Knowledge and understanding of copyright legislation and contractual processes.
  • A proven track record in high-level creative concepts.
  • Experience working with creative and commercial teams and managing expectations in a fast-paced environment.
  • Excellent project management skills & interpersonal skills.
  • An enthusiastic, organized, and personable team player.
  • Knowledge of cameras and lighting kit.

Pay

Base pay range: $130,000 - $160,000. We’re committed to offering competitive and flexible compensation to attract top talent. This pay range reflects our good faith estimate for the role and may vary based on a candidate’s experience, skills, location, and other relevant factors. For bonus-eligible roles, targets are determined based on multiple considerations, including market benchmarks and individual contributions.

Benefits

For benefits-eligible roles, we offer a comprehensive and competitive benefits package covering health, retirement, wellbeing, and more, along with optional benefits to meet the diverse needs of our employees.
